Mihgawan Chhakka

Mihgawan Chhakka is a village located in Shahnagar tehsil of Panna district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Shahnagar (tehsildar office) and 105km away from district headquarter Panna. As per 2009 stats, Mahguwan Chhakka is the gram panchayat of Mihgawan Chhakka village.

About Mihgawan Chhakka

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mihgawan Chhakka is 459378. The village spans a total geographical area of 476.89 hectares. Katni is nearest town to Mihgawan Chhakka village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Mihgawan Chhakka

According to the 2011 Census, Mihgawan Chhakka has a total population of about 1,139, with approximately 611 males and 528 females. The sex ratio is around 864 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 163 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 215 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 359. The overall literacy rate is approximately 60.14%, with male literacy at about 70.70% and female literacy near 47.92%. There are around 280 households in the village. Connectivity of Mihgawan Chhakka

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mihgawan Chhakka. As per the 2011 stats, Mihgawan Chhakka had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
